About this topic

Highest level of schooling shows the highest year of primary or secondary school completed by people aged 15 years and over. It describes school attainment rather than post-school qualifications.

This topic helps indicate educational attainment and can support analysis of access to employment, training, and services. It is best read with qualifications and other socio-economic indicators, because school completion alone does not show a person's full skill profile.

Interpretation notes

  • This records the highest year of primary or secondary school completed by people aged 15 years and over.
  • It is not a measure of post-school qualifications, so it should be read with non-school qualifications for full attainment.

Key insight

In 2021, Year 12 or Equivalent was the most common schooling level among residents aged 15 and over in Kelso (NSW), accounting for 44.1% (3,438 people). This share was lower than Bathurst Regional (A) (46.2%). Since 2016, the biggest change was in Year 12 or Equivalent, which increased by 691 people and 3.8 percentage points.
